LC2000 netserver beeps

The server beeps for about 1 minute and then stops. This recurs once in a few days. What could cause the beeps and how can I track it down?

Re: LC2000 netserver beeps

What do the beeps sound like? Do they come in any pattern at all? If you hear a series of single beeps that occur about 1 a second, then it might be a NetRAID alarm warning you of a failing RAID array.

Re: LC2000 netserver beeps

Thank you for the reply.

It could be the UPS, not the server, that beeped. The UPS, sitting right next to the server, had a red warning light on and I did not notice it until today. I replaced the UPS with a simple power strip and I have not heard any beeps so far, hoply never. Thanks again for the help.
